Product Data Sheet
SENTRY-KOTE™
Fluid-Applied, Cold-Applied, Polyurethane Waterproofing Membrane
DESCRIPTION
SENTRY-KOTE is a cold-applied, fluid-applied, polyurethane waterproofing membrane. The product provides a seamless, elastic waterproofing membrane. This membrane is weathertight and flexible to maintain durability during extreme temperatures and freeze/thaw cycles.
USES
SENTRY-KOTE is suitable for use on interior or exterior concrete surfaces, where protection from water intrusion is desired. The product is designed for horizontal applications, interior or exterior. Suitable substrates include concrete, metal, single-ply EPDM, and bitumen felt. Suitable applications include roofs, water tanks, balconies, terraces, shower and bath floors, kitchens, and light pedestrian traffic areas, such as stairs, stadiums, and grandstands.

PACKAGING
55 Lb. (25 kg) Pail
COVERAGE
1 kg/square meter (0.20 Pounds per square foot (psf))
SHELF LIFE
When stored indoors and in original, unopened containers at temperatures between (4° – 21° C, shelf life is one year from date of manufacture.

APPLICATION
Surface Preparation … All surfaces must be clean (free of all coatings and curing compounds), free of frost, relatively smooth, and structurally sound. Conduct a bond test to assure proper surface preparation has been accomplished.
Mixing… Mix well before using. Mix using a low-speed mixer
Priming … Apply appropriate primer to surfaces that will be covered within one working day. If left exposed overnight, additional adhesive must be applied. Follow all instructions and precautions on containers. All substrates must be clean, dry, and free of all surface irregularities. Appropriate primer is determined by humidity and moisture conditions at time of application.
Application Method … Optimum surface and air temperature is between 4º and 40º C during application. Apply when the surface temperature is always 3º above the dew point. Apply by roller,
brush, or spreader. Apply in two different colored coats at 1 kg/m2 (.205 lb./ft.2) each. It is recommended to use all material in the container. Use a spiked roller immediately after application to reduce bubbling.
Drying Time… Drying time varies based on temperature and humidity at time of application. Drying time will be longer with higher temps and humidity. Drying times can range from four hours up to 35 hours based on these conditions. Contact W. R. MEADOWS technical services for more specific information. Keep free from foot traffic for two days. Allow 10 – 15 days for drying before contact to water.
Cleanup… Uncured SENTRY-KOTE cleans up easily with alcohol or other solvents. Cured material must be removed by mechanical means.
PRECAUTIONS
Product should not be applied during high moisture conditions. These conditions could cause bubble formation under the membrane surface. SENTRY-KOTE is an aromatic-based polyurethane. If exposed to sunlight, it will yellow. SENTRY-KOTE is a relatively soft coating. If exposed to pedestrian traffic (even light pedestrian traffic), a color-pigmented protective topcoat is recommended.
